What is HSBC Asset Management? Clear Definition & Core Concepts
HSBC Asset Management refers to the investment division of HSBC Group, offering institutional and retail investors a broad array of funds and strategies designed to preserve and grow wealth.
Key Entities & Concepts
- Active management: ESG-driven equity/fixed income funds and multi-asset portfolios.
- Alternative investments: Including real estate, private equity, and hedge funds.
- Global reach: Operations in over 20 countries, enabling access to diverse markets.
- Risk management: Sophisticated analytics for portfolio construction.

Frequently Asked Questions about HSBC Asset Management
-
What types of funds does HSBC Asset Management offer?
HSBC offers equity, fixed income, multi-asset, alternatives, and ESG-integrated funds. -
How does HSBC incorporate ESG in its investment process?
HSBC uses proprietary ESG scoring combined with third-party data for portfolio construction. -
Can individual investors access HSBC’s funds?
Yes, through retail platforms and global fund distributors. -
What is the performance benchmark for HSBC funds?
Each fund benchmarks against appropriate indices such as MSCI or Bloomberg Barclays. -
How often are portfolios rebalanced?
Typically quarterly or upon significant market changes.
